Clean politics will triumph over money power: Ardent Basaiawmoit

Shillong, Feb 4: VPP president and Nongkrem candidate, Ardent Basaiawmoit is hopeful that clean politics will triumph over money power and corruption.

Speaking to reporters after filing his nomination paper, he attacked the ruling NPP-led MDA coalition for the numerous cases of corruption and irregularities.

Criticising the regional parties of the coalition for not sticking to their promise of taking care of the issue of the people, he said the regional fronts of the State were spineless and only concerned about winning and retaining the power.

He also clarified that he had never said that he did not want the non-tribals vote in the last election, but that he was for the cause of the indigenous people. His statement was distorted in the media, he said.
